Transaction 1404f38c90fb72fa2665022f26aead5cb08e9a73388c3eaf5f52008dfbd779b6

2 Input
1 Outputs
  • 1404f38c90fb72fa2665022f26aead5cb08e9a73388c3eaf5f52008dfbd779b6:0
  • value  705192
    address  3FaQGAHK3wVU3MniZeCogSBpzRDvT1F8Gv